一、创建.lldbinit
command alias reveal_load expr (void*)dlopen((char*)[(NSString*)[(NSBundle*)[NSBundle mainBundle] pathForResource:@"libReveal" ofType:@"dylib"] cStringUsingEncoding:0x4], 0x2);
command alias reveal_start expr (void)[(NSNotificationCenter*)[NSNotificationCenter defaultCenter] postNotificationName:@"IBARevealRequestStart" object:nil];
command alias reveal_stop expr (void)[(NSNotificationCenter*)[NSNotificationCenter defaultCenter] postNotificationName:@"IBARevealRequestStop" object:nil];
二、创建脚本lazy-copy-reveal.sh
#!/bin/sh
APPBUNDLEPATH="${TARGET_BUILD_DIR}/${EXECUTABLE_NAME}.app/"
REVEALFRAMEWORKPATH="/Applications/Reveal.app/Contents/SharedSupport/iOS-Libraries/libReveal.dylib"
if [ -f "${REVEALFRAMEWORKPATH}" ] && [ "${CONFIGURATION}" == "Debug" ]; then
cp "${REVEALFRAMEWORKPATH}" "${APPBUNDLEPATH}"
fi
分享到:
相关推荐
1. **集成reveal.js到React项目**: - 安装reveal.js:在你的React项目根目录下,运行`npm install reveal.js --save`来添加这个库。 - 在`public/index.html`中引入reveal.js所需的CSS和JavaScript文件,确保它们...
Reveal 软件提供了几个关键的可用性优势,包括与金刚石设计流程的集成、一键式操作、将调试逻辑插入到设计中用于修改原始设计或调试配置的简单流程、高级触发功能、逻辑分析器波形可用性等。 Reveal 软件包含两个...
集成Reveal意味着开发者可以更方便地调试界面,调整布局,优化用户体验。 基于以上描述,我们可以推断出以下几个相关的知识点: 1. **iOS应用开发**:使用Objective-C或Swift语言进行,这两个语言是苹果官方支持的...
- **插件集成**:Revelry支持集成Reveal.js的各种插件,扩展幻灯片的功能,如数学公式渲染、代码高亮、图表绘制等。 - **持续集成**:对于开发团队来说,Revelry还可以与版本控制系统和持续集成工具集成,确保代码...
集成 Reveal 和 FLEX 成果演示 - 抖音APP示例 1. 介绍 Reveal 和 FLEX Reveal 是什么 Reveal是一个iOS程序界面调试工具,可以在Reveal上查看视图的层级和修改控件的属性,用来调试UI。 Reveal允许开发者在不修改代码...
- **插件集成**:Reveal.js有许多可选的插件,如图表、代码高亮、数学公式等,学习如何安装和使用这些插件可以增强幻灯片的功能。 - **交互设计**:如何在幻灯片中添加交互元素,如按钮、表单、动画等,以提高用户...
5. **嵌入多媒体**:可以轻松地将图片、视频、音频等多媒体元素集成到幻灯片中。 6. **代码高亮**:支持多种编程语言的代码高亮显示,适合技术分享。 7. **扩展插件**:拥有丰富的插件生态系统,如数学公式渲染、...
**标题:“reveal.js-master下载”** **描述:“滚屏式脚本编写 html JavaScript”** **标签:“reveal.js”** 本文将深入探讨`reveal.js`框架,它是一款基于HTML和JavaScript的开源幻灯片制作工具,允许用户...
Reveal 20可以无缝集成到Xcode开发环境中,开发者可以直接在代码中设置断点,然后在Reveal中观察和调试界面。这种紧密的集成极大地提高了开发效率。 5. **协作与分享** 新版本支持团队协作,开发者可以将界面状态...
通过与Xcode集成,Reveal使开发者能够在运行时检查和调整应用的界面元素,极大地提升了UI调试的效率。 首先,Reveal的核心特性在于其可视化界面。它能呈现应用的界面层次,以树形结构显示每个视图及其属性,包括...
通过与Xcode集成,开发者可以在设备或模拟器上运行应用的同时,实时查看和修改UI元素的属性。这种即时反馈极大地提高了调试速度,减少了反复编译和运行的次数,从而提升了开发效率。 其次,Reveal提供了层次视图,...
- **调试辅助**:如RevealPlugin,集成Reveal工具,帮助可视化UI调试。 - **快捷键定制**:如KeyCommands,允许自定义快捷键,提高工作效率。 **注意事项** 虽然Xcode插件能极大地提升开发效率,但也有可能引入...
7. **集成到Xcode**:Reveal可以方便地与Xcode集成,通过简单的步骤,开发者可以在Xcode的IDE内直接使用Reveal的功能。 8. **版本更新**:提到的版本号24,可能包含了最新的性能优化、新功能添加或对现有功能的改进...
Reveal-Plugin-for-Xcode, Xcode插件,将显示应用集成到你的项目自动化 Reveal-Plugin-for-Xcode Xcode插件将显示应用集成到你的项目自动( 。没有对你的项目进行任何修改) 中。请注意,Xcode 8不支持插件。 有关更多...
- **安装与配置**:首先需要在Mac上安装Reveal软件,并获取与Xcode集成的插件或库。 - **集成到项目**:将Reveal提供的SDK导入到iOS项目中,设置适当的配置选项。 - **运行与连接**:在Xcode中启动项目,Reveal会...
同时,reveal.js也支持JavaScript插件系统,允许开发者通过API接口扩展功能,如集成第三方库,添加额外的交互元素,或者定制特定的动画效果。 总的来说,reveal.js是HTML5和CSS3技术在现代网页设计中的一次精彩应用...
其次,理解Reveal与Xcode的集成方式,可以通过Xcode的插件或者命令行工具来启动应用并与Reveal进行连接。最后,对于版本控制,开发者需要妥善处理Reveal生成的配置文件,避免不必要的冲突。 Reveal对于团队协作也有...
6. **多媒体集成**:可以轻松插入图片、视频和音频,增强演示的互动性和吸引力。 7. **扩展与插件**:Reveal.js有一个活跃的社区,提供了许多插件和扩展,如数学公式渲染、实时协作等,进一步丰富了功能。 ### ...
使用reveal.js,开发者可以通过修改这些文件来自定义他们的演示文稿,包括更改主题、添加过渡效果、集成外部数据或者实现自定义交互。此外,由于这是一个开源项目,社区提供了丰富的文档、教程和示例,帮助开发者更...
7. **第三方库支持**:Reveal不仅适用于原生的UIKit,还可以与许多第三方库集成,如React Native和Flutter,为跨平台开发提供便利。 8. **自定义视图查看**:对于自定义视图,Reveal可以提供定制的查看器,使开发者...